A cube has a volume of 729 cubic centimeters. What can be concluded about the cube? Check all that apply. Recall the formula mr0

21-1.jpg. The side length, s, can be found using the equation mr021-2.jpg This is a perfect cube. The side length is 243 centimeters. The side length is 9 centimeters. Taking the cube root of the volume will determine the side length. If you multiply the volume by three, you can determine the side length.

Answer:

This is a perfect cube

The side length is 9 centimeters

Taking the cube root of the volume will determine the side length

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The volume of a cube is equal to

V=s^{3}

where

s is the length side of the cube

In this problem we have

V=729\ cm^{3}

Solve for s-------> that means isolate the variable s

Find the length side of the cube s

s=\sqrt[3]{V}

substitute the value of V

s=\sqrt[3]{729}=9\ cm --------> a perfect cube

therefore

Statements

This is a perfect cube--------> Is true

The side length is 9 centimeters -------> Is true

Taking the cube root of the volume will determine the side length ------> Is true
